1. Loan Options and Strategies to Manage Student Debt

Federal Student Loans

Federal student loans are typically the first and most accessible option for students pursuing community college programs. The primary types include Direct Subsidized Loans, Direct Unsubsidized Loans, and potentially, Direct PLUS Loans for parents or graduate students. For students enrolled in the Energy Systems Technologies/Technicians program, these loans offer favorable interest rates and flexible repayment options.

State and Institutional Loans

While Illinois does not have specific state-funded student loans, some community colleges partner with local banks or financial institutions offering private education loans. Students should exercise caution with private loans, as they often have higher interest rates and less flexible repayment terms. Always compare these with federal options before borrowing.

Strategies to Manage and Minimize Debt

To effectively manage student debt, students should consider the following strategies: - Borrow only what is necessary: Calculate the total costs and borrow minimally. - Complete financial aid applications early: Apply for federal aid through the Free Application for Federal Student Aid (FAFSA) to access grants and loans. - Explore scholarships and grants: Seek scholarships specific to energy technology fields or community college programs. - Opt for part-time work: Combine employment with studies to reduce reliance on loans. - Understand repayment plans: Choose income-driven repayment options to maintain manageable monthly payments post-graduation.

2. Program Overview and What Students Will Study

Program Description

The Energy Systems Technologies/Technicians program at Richland Community College prepares students to install, maintain, and repair energy systems, including renewable energy sources like solar, wind, and geothermal. As a technical program, it emphasizes hands-on training combined with foundational science and engineering principles.

Curriculum Components

Students will learn: - Electrical systems and circuitry - Renewable energy technologies - HVAC systems related to energy efficiency - Safety protocols and industry standards - System troubleshooting and maintenance - Use of diagnostic and installation tools

Skills Acquired

Graduates will develop technical proficiency in energy systems, problem-solving skills, and an understanding of sustainable energy practices, positioning them well for various roles within the energy sector.

3. Career Opportunities and Job Prospects

Job Outlook

The demand for skilled technicians in energy systems is on the rise, driven by increasing investments in renewable energy and energy efficiency. According to the U.S. Bureau of Labor Statistics, electrical and renewable energy technicians are expected to experience above-average growth, making this a promising field for employment.

Potential Careers

Graduates can pursue roles such as: - Renewable Energy Technician - Solar PV Installer - Wind Turbine Service Technician - HVAC Technician specializing in energy-efficient systems - Energy Auditor - Maintenance Technician for energy systems

Salary Expectations

Entry-level technicians typically earn between $40,000 to $60,000 annually, with experienced professionals and specialists earning higher wages. Geographic location and employer type influence salary ranges.
